Looking for Course 15873 test answers and solutions? Browse our comprehensive collection of verified answers for Course 15873 at edu.vik.bme.hu.
Get instant access to accurate answers and detailed explanations for your course questions. Our community-driven platform helps students succeed!
Igaz, vagy hamis? A destruktor mindig meghívja a tartalmazott objektumok destruktorait.
Adott a következő osztály:
class intT { int array[100];public: int operator[](size_t idx) { return array[idx]; }};
Helyes-e a következő kódrészlet?
intT t;t[0] = 100;
Igaz, vagy hamis? Absztrakt osztálynak nem kell, hogy legyen tisztán virtuális tagfüggvénye.
Minden osztálynak kötelező alapértelmezett (paraméter nélküli) konstruktort írni!
Adott a következő deklaráció: const char *p;
Igaz, vagy hamis? p változó értéke nem változtatható meg.
Milyen bővítéseket és változtatásokat vezettek be C++-ban a C99 szabványhoz képest? (jó válasz +0.25, rossz -0.25)
Hányszor hívódik meg az alábbi kódrészletben a Komplex osztály destruktora?
{Komplex *k = new Komplex(400);delete k;}
Mi olvasható le az alábbi osztálydiagramról?
Jelölje, hogy melyik állítás helyes!
Jelölje, hogy mely állítás(ok) hamis(ak) a C++ nyelvvel kapcsolatban!(Minden bejelölt válasz 1 pont, ha helyes, -1 pont, ha hibás!)
Igaz vagy hamis a következő állítás a lenti osztállyal kapcsolatban:
"Egy Komplex objektumhoz jobbról és balról is hozzáadható egy lebegőpontos (double) szám."
class Komplex{ double re, im;public: Komplex(double re = 0.0, double im = 0.0); Komplex konjugalt() const; Komplex operator+(double re) const;};